refind是uefi环境下使用的引导器, 如果一台设备上有N个系统,那么有必要了解一下refind如
何来引导。但因为默认的引导效果是非常杂乱的,我们需要做一些工作。
一、安装refind
参考这篇文章
https://blog.csdn.net/qq_41601836/article/details/106485785
二、去掉不必要的启动项
编辑boot/efi/EFI/refind/refind.conf
在最后加上
dont_scan_dirs \efi\boot //不扫描boot目录
scan_all_linux_kernels false //不加载所有的Linux内核
之后, 我们看到refind只保留我们所想要的了.
三、设置启动时间为0
从refind的菜单进入mac之后是clover,进入Linux是grub2,所以必须把默认时间改为0,这样refind才算完美!
(1)mac
clover的修改可以借助Clover Configurator,很方便的修改启动时间
(2)Linux
执行:
sudo vim /etc/grub.d/30_os-prober
修改 set timeout=0
执行:
sudo gedit /etc/default/grub
修改 GRUB_TIMEOUT=0
执行:
sudo update-grub
更新grub配置文件
有些linux没有这个脚本,执行:
update-grub 实际就是 grub-mkconfig -o /boot/grub/grub.cfg
更新
如何使用clover引导win10+deepin15.11+macOS10.15.4请参考这篇文章:
http://baijiahao.baidu.com/s?id=1663113368107229448
end
参考:
https://mbd.baidu.com/newspage/data/landingshare?context=%7B%22nid%22%3A%22news_9906880781631123551%22%2C%22ssid%22%3A%2235cf02a0%22%7D&pageType=1
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)